In-State vs Out-of-State Tuition

Kettering College is listed as Private nonprofit in the local dataset. In-state tuition is $15,672 and out-of-state tuition is $15,672. The reported in-state and out-of-state tuition values match in this dataset.

International Student and Private College Tuition Note

The local database lists Kettering College as Private nonprofit. Private colleges commonly report one tuition rate rather than separate resident and nonresident rates. In this dataset, Kettering College reports $15,672 for out-of-state tuition and $15,672 for in-state tuition. International student billing, visa expenses, health insurance and aid eligibility should be verified directly with the school.

Average Net Price After Aid

Based on available data, the average student at Kettering College pays approximately $15,156 per year after grants and aid. This is below the Ohio average of $17,854 and below the national average of $17,506.

Financial Aid and Scholarships

About 24.19% of Kettering College students receive federal Pell grants, indicating the share of students receiving this need-based aid in the local dataset. 46.20% take federal loans, which helps families understand borrowing patterns alongside net price.

Student Debt and Borrowing

Borrowing metrics help explain how students finance the gap between sticker price, aid and net price. Loans can make a bill payable, but they do not reduce the underlying cost like grants and scholarships.

Loan principal

$19,456

Median completer debt

$23,500

Median monthly payment

$249

Federal loan rate

46.20%

Debt and payment fields come from federal aid data where reported. Actual borrowing can vary by degree level, dependency status, aid package, family contribution and program costs.

Accreditation

Kettering College lists Higher Learning Commission as its accreditor in the local dataset. Institutional accreditation is an important trust signal and can affect federal financial aid eligibility. Accreditation means an external agency has reviewed academic quality and institutional standards, which helps families verify whether federal aid pathways such as Pell grants and federal loans may apply.
